“…Subsequently, the PGDS has been gradually innovated and developed in the pile foundation engineering, mainly including the Gravel Basket Device [8], the High Pressure Bi-directional Loading Cells [9], the Sleeve Valve Tube Grouting Device [10], the Frustum Confining Vessel [11,12], the U-shaped Tube Grouting Device [13], the Punching and Binding Grouting Technology [14], and the Reserved Cavity Grouting with Movable Steel Plate [15]. Many researchers have carried out field or model tests to measure its bearing capacity of the PSDS [16][17][18]. Meanwhile, the reinforcing mechanism of the PGDS has been revealed, which mainly consists of the reinforcement effect of grouting material on soil at the pile tip [19][20][21], the enlargement of the pile tip [22,23], the reinforcement effect of grouting split along the pile shaft [24,25], and the negative friction of the pile shaft caused by grouting [26,27].…”
